Presentation
DBV is a Scared Stiff specific mod that receives its information directly from the DMC controller.
Originally, the eyes of the "Bony Beast" were simple red lamps. With this mod, they are replaced by realistic and animated pupils.
They are made with miniature OLED screens and covered with an oval glass lens. As these test charts show, the two screens are independent and can display different images.
The microcontroller is installed in the skull and the connection to the DPS is made by a three-wire cable.
The drawing of the pupils is of photographic quality and can move both horizontally and vertically (and simultaneously if necessary).
On this prototype, the white background makes it possible to distinguish the shape of the oval mask (vinyl cover cut with a plotter). On the final version, the bottom of the eye is black to blend in perfectly with the whole.
Up to 8 eye models are available and chosen according to the phases of the game. In order to be able to fit everything into the memory of the microcontroller, a specific compression algorithm was used.

Besides pupil movements, many animations are also coded in the DBV. Thus the beating of the eyes, or a simple wink of an eye make the beast alive. When the mission "EYES OF THE BONY BEAST" is completed, the eyes turn red. When a capture is possible, they turn green; and when this is done, a grid closes on them.
